Helping Children Experience the JOY of Giving

Helping Children Experience the JOY of Giving

Christmas is known as the season of giving, but that might be a difficult concept for children to understand. With the onslaught of holiday ads, it’s only natural for them to ponder “getting” vs. “giving” during the holidays. While receiving gifts usually produces a good feeling, research indicates that giving creates an even greater joy.
